My approach is built on connection, not repetition. Instead of reciting formulas, I design personalized mathematical journeys using the Concrete-Pictorial-Abstract (CPA) model—helping students turn abstract concepts into real understanding.

My students begin with real-world applications they can touch and manipulate, progress to visual models that bridge comprehension, and ultimately master abstract equations with genuine confidence. This isn't about memorization—it's about rewiring how a mind processes mathematical thinking.
